编程逻辑工具是什么东西

worktile 其他 9

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程逻辑工具是一些软件或技术,用于帮助程序员在编写代码时更好地组织和处理数据、控制程序流程、进行错误处理和调试等。这些工具能够提供一些方便的功能和方法,以便程序员能够更高效地编写和调试代码。

    下面是几种常见的编程逻辑工具:

    1. 流程图:流程图是一种图形化的表示方法,用于描述程序的执行流程。它通过使用不同的符号和线条来表示不同的操作和决策,帮助程序员更直观地理解和设计程序的逻辑。

    2. 伪代码:伪代码是一种类似于自然语言的编程语言,用于描述程序的算法和逻辑。它不依赖于具体的编程语言,而是用简单的语句和关键字来表示程序的执行步骤和判断条件,方便程序员进行思路的整理和算法的设计。

    3. 调试器:调试器是一种用于查找和修复程序错误的工具。它可以让程序员逐步执行代码,查看变量的值和程序的执行状态,以便找到错误的原因和位置。调试器还可以提供断点、单步执行、变量监视等功能,帮助程序员更方便地进行代码调试和错误排查。

    4. 单元测试框架:单元测试框架是一种用于编写和执行单元测试的工具。它提供了一组函数和断言,用于验证程序的各个单元是否按照预期进行工作。通过编写和运行单元测试,程序员可以更早地发现和修复代码中的问题,提高代码的质量和稳定性。

    5. 集成开发环境(IDE):集成开发环境是一种集成了编译器、调试器、编辑器等工具的软件,用于开发和调试程序。IDE提供了代码自动完成、语法检查、代码重构等功能,帮助程序员更高效地编写和管理代码。

    总之,编程逻辑工具是程序员在编写和调试代码时使用的一些软件或技术,帮助他们更好地组织和处理程序的逻辑,提高代码的质量和效率。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程逻辑工具是一些用于帮助程序员设计和实现逻辑结构的工具。它们可以帮助程序员组织和管理代码,提高代码的可读性和可维护性。以下是几种常见的编程逻辑工具:

    1. 流程图:流程图是一种图形化的表达方式,用于展示程序的执行流程和逻辑关系。它使用不同的图形符号来表示不同的操作和决策,如开始和结束节点、过程节点、条件节点等。通过绘制流程图,程序员可以清晰地了解程序的执行流程,帮助他们设计和调试代码。

    2. 伪代码:伪代码是一种类似于自然语言的描述方式,用于描述算法和程序逻辑。它不是一种具体的编程语言,而是一种简化和抽象的描述方式。通过使用伪代码,程序员可以更容易地理解和沟通算法和程序逻辑,而无需关注具体的编程语法和细节。

    3. 状态图:状态图是一种图形化的描述方式,用于表示程序在不同状态之间的转换和处理逻辑。它由状态节点和转换箭头组成,每个状态节点表示程序的一种状态,转换箭头表示状态之间的转换条件和动作。状态图可以帮助程序员清晰地了解程序的状态变化和处理逻辑,有助于设计和实现复杂的状态机。

    4. 逻辑运算符:逻辑运算符是用于组合和比较布尔值的运算符。常见的逻辑运算符包括与运算符(&&)、或运算符(||)、非运算符(!)等。通过使用逻辑运算符,程序员可以根据不同的条件执行不同的代码逻辑,实现程序的分支和循环结构。

    5. 调试工具:调试工具是用于帮助程序员识别和修复代码错误的工具。它们提供了一系列的功能,如断点设置、变量查看、堆栈跟踪等,可以帮助程序员跟踪代码的执行过程,定位和解决问题。调试工具是程序员在开发和调试过程中不可或缺的工具,可以提高程序的质量和可靠性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程逻辑工具是一种用于帮助程序员设计和实现程序逻辑的辅助工具。它们可以帮助程序员更好地组织和管理程序代码,提高代码的可读性和可维护性。编程逻辑工具可以分为以下几种类型:

    1. 流程图:流程图是一种用图形符号表示程序流程的工具。它使用不同的图形符号来表示程序的各个步骤、决策和循环,使程序的逻辑结构更加清晰可见。流程图通常使用矩形框表示步骤,使用菱形框表示决策,使用圆角矩形框表示输入输出,使用箭头表示流程的走向。

    2. 伪代码:伪代码是一种类似于自然语言的编程语言,用于描述程序逻辑而不关注具体的编程语言细节。它可以帮助程序员快速地描述程序的算法和逻辑,以便更好地理解和讨论程序的设计。伪代码通常使用类似于英语的语法来描述程序的步骤和操作。

    3. 程序流程控制语句:编程语言中的流程控制语句可以帮助程序员控制程序的执行流程。例如,条件语句(如if语句和switch语句)可以根据条件选择不同的执行路径,循环语句(如for循环和while循环)可以重复执行一段代码块,跳转语句(如break语句和continue语句)可以改变程序的执行流程。

    4. 调试工具:调试工具是一种用于帮助程序员找到程序中的错误并修复它们的工具。调试工具可以提供一些特殊的功能,如断点调试、单步执行、变量监视等,以帮助程序员更好地理解程序的执行流程和变量的状态,从而找到错误并进行修复。

    总之,编程逻辑工具是一种帮助程序员设计和实现程序逻辑的辅助工具,可以通过流程图、伪代码、程序流程控制语句和调试工具等方式来提高程序的可读性和可维护性。它们在软件开发过程中起着重要的作用,能够帮助程序员更好地组织和管理程序代码,提高程序的质量和效率。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部